Requisition ID: 207049 Join a purpose driven winning team, committed to results, in an inclusive and high-performing culture. **What you’ll be doing** Our Advisors are customer-centric and able to connect with people in a relatable way. As an essential member of the Canadian Banking Branch network, the focus is to provide exceptional service throughout the customer’s journey by: - Manage an assigned portfolio of high value and/or complex small business owner relationships to achieve retention and other negotiated goals while meeting Scotiabank’s Service Standard - Creating a strong presence within the local business community by developing relationships with various Centres of Influence - Proactively engage with new and existing clients to build strong, ongoing relationships and provide comprehensive advice, enabling them to build successful businesses - Partner with fellow advisors to create a customer centric environment **What you have** - You possess a results oriented attitude and have sound knowledge of the small business market including the features and benefits of small business products and services, including; an understanding of financial statements, applicable risk management policies and legal and security documentation for small business products - You demonstrate excellent business development techniques and are conversant with small business legal structures and life cycles, competitor offerings and alternate sources of financing - You have good organizational skills and are flexible to adapt to a constantly changing environment - You are a strong relationship builder and communicator; and enjoy meeting people and are proficient at collaborating with others - You have an education in a business related discipline or equivalent work experience as a small business owner - Valid driver’s license and access to a reliable vehicle **What we’re offering** - The opportunity to join a forward-thinking company with the ability to collaborate with other business lines within the bank - A rewarding career path with diverse opportunities for professional development - A competitive compensation and benefits package - Internal training to support your growth and enhance your skills - An organization committed to making a difference in our communities - for you and our customers Location(s): Canada : Ontario : Mississauga || Canada : Ontario : Brampton || Canada : Ontario : Etobicoke || Canada : Ontario : Milton || Canada : Ontario : Oakville Scotiabank is a leading bank in the Americas. Guided by our purpose: "for every future", we help our customers, their families and their communities achieve success through a broad range of advice, products and services, including personal and commercial banking, wealth management and private banking, corporate and investment banking, and capital markets.
